Chapter 369 - Magic Of Silver-Grey Eyes

The back garden looked nothing like the church itself. It wasn't noisy, nor did it feel cramped.

The air carried the faint scent of snow and freshly brewed coffee, set on a small circular table.

For a fleeting moment, Xion wondered why these people from the church were so obsessed with their drinks.

Luckily, it wasn't jasmine, or he might've turned right back.

At the paladin's polite gesture, Xion took a seat on one of the two chairs.

The arrangement alone made it clear: only the holy priest and his personally invited guest were to sit.

But did the knight care? Of course not.

Under the paladin's incredulous gaze, Ray dragged the chair next to Xion and dropped into it without a shred of ceremony.

"I'm afraid we might need another chair," Xion said to the paladin, pulling back his hood.

It was pointless to hide his face now.

"…I understand."

Was it just Xion's imagination, or did he catch a hint of resentment in the paladin's eyes? It was definitely aimed at Ray.
